Personal care is a term we use to refer to supporting you with personal hygiene and toileting, along with dressing and maintaining your personal appearance.


Some personal care tasks include:

  • Bathing and showering
  • Medication administration*
  • Applying lotions and creams as required
  • Dressing and getting ready for bed
  • Oral hygiene
  • Support with shaving
  • Foot care, especially if you are diabetic need to be extra vigilant with your feet (not podiatry or nail cutting)
  • Helping you to the toilet, including using a commode or bed pan
  • Changing continence pads, along with cleaning intimate areas
  • Support moving position in bed, to stretch and prevent bed sores


Care assistants are trained to provide all aspects of personal care, yet there may be some things you’d prefer to do for yourself - let us know.  

* Some exceptions apply subject to individual medical needs
